Marauders Earn Series Victory Behind Pimentel’s Go-Ahead Homer
Iredale drives in three with a triple, Bradenton earns first series win since May
Antonio Pimentel sent a go-ahead homer over the right field wall to open up the seventh, leading the Bradenton Marauders (2-1, 33-35) to an 8-3 win over the Clearwater Threshers (1-2, 41-28) on Sunday from LECOM Park. Brent Iredale drove in three runs with a triple, and Bradenton secured their first series win since early May.
In the bottom of the first, Pimentel reached on a fielding error, moved to second on a single by Edgleen Perez, and came around to score on a throwing error to make it 1-0.
Perez singled to lead off the bottom of the third and plated on a double from Richard Ramirez to make it a 2-0 ballgame.
After the Threshers tied the game, the Marauders’ offense exploded in the bottom of the seventh. Pimentel homered, putting Bradenton up 3-2. Perez walked, Bralyn Brazoban singled, and Ramirez walked to load the bases. Hyun Sueng Lee walked, scoring Perez to move the score, 4-2. A triple from Iredale cleared the bases and made it a 7-2 ballgame.
In the bottom of the eighth, Pimentel walked, moved to third on a single by Brazoban, and scored on a fielding error to make it 8-2.
Despite a run by Clearwater in the top of the ninth, the Threshers went scoreless the rest of the way to finalize an 8-3 win for the Marauders.
Dariel Francia (1-0) earned the win tossing a scoreless 0.1 frames. MT Morrissey (3-2) took the loss, allowing five runs on three hits, three walks, and a strikeout over 1.0 inning.
Bradenton takes the day off on Monday before traveling on the road to begin a six-game series against the Palm Beach Cardinals on Tuesday. First pitch from Roger Dean Chevrolet Stadium is set for 6:30 p.m. EST.
